Definition: A truck bed rack, also known as a cargo carrier or pickup truck bed accessory, is a specialized mounting system designed to secure and transport various types of cargo on the rear bed of a pickup truck or similar vehicles. It consists of a framework that can be attached to the existing bed of the vehicle, providing a robust platform for loading and unloading goods.

Historical Context: The concept of truck bed racks can be traced back to the early 20th century when pickup trucks first emerged as versatile workhorses. As the demand for off-road transportation and cargo hauling grew, innovators sought ways to maximize cargo space. Early racks were simple affairs, designed primarily to carry heavy items like agricultural equipment or construction tools. Over time, these evolved into more sophisticated systems, driven by advancements in material science and manufacturing techniques.

Q: Are truck bed racks suitable for all types of vehicles?
A: While many racks are designed for pickup trucks, there are options available for various vehicle types, including SUVs, vans, and even some sedans with modified beds. However, proper fitment depends on the specific rack design and vehicle model.
Q: How do I choose the right truck bed rack for my needs?
A: Consider factors like cargo type (bulky vs. smaller items), frequency of use, vehicle model compatibility, and budget. Research different rack types and consult with experts to make an informed decision.
